Solution Overview

Problem

Existing sleep mask devices do not effectively allow users to comfortably rest their forehead against a support while sleeping in a seated position, as they lack a functional flap portion to provide adequate cushioning and support.

Innovation Solution

A sleep mask with a foldable flap portion that can be positioned against the forehead, combined with elastomeric straps for secure fitting, enabling users to rest comfortably against a support object, such as a seat backrest, while sleeping in a seated position.

AI summary

A sleep mask assembly includes a sleep mask that is wearable on a user's face such that the sleep mask covers the user's eyes. The sleep mask has a face portion and a flap portion. The face portion rests against the user's face when the sleep mask is worn. The flap portion is positionable in a deployed position has the flap portion resting against the user's forehead to facilitate the user to comfortably rest their forehead against a support object when the user is sleeping in a sitting position. The flap portion is positionable in a stored position having the flap portion resting against the face portion. A pair of elastomeric straps is each coupled to the sleep mask thereby facilitating the pair of elastomeric straps to be worn around the user's head for retaining the sleep mask on the user's face.
